Pine Crest School graduate Kaelin Braverman ’25, 2024-25 editor-in-chief of Pine Crest's Upper School student newspaper “The Paw Print,” earned second place in the Best Article category of the 2025 NEHS–Harvard Crimson Student Journalism competition.

Open to student members of the National English Honor Society, the award recognizes excellence in both content and journalistic style for articles published in school publications. Judges praised Kaelin's piece, "Joggling: For the People Who Think Running is Too Easy" for its extreme high quality.
